BAMBER BRIDGE RESERVES (4) 4
ALTRINCHAM RESERVES (0) 1

Lancit Haulage Lancashire League Match
played on Saturday, 27 August, 2005


LINE-UP

ALTRINCHAM RESERVES: 1. Lee MILNER, 2. Paul MONAGHAN, 3. Ryan STEWART 4. James MARSDEN (capt), 5. Colin McALLISTER, 6. Griff JONES, 7. Mike BROWN, 8. John MALONEY, 9. Dwaine LINDSAY, 10. Kwame BARNETT, 11. Pat McFADDEN. Subs: 12. Michael SUTTON, 13. Craig ELLISON (gk), 14. Daniel HEFFERNAN, 15. Anthony BINGHAM.


REPORT

Based on information kindly provided by Neil Brown.

Altrincham Reserves had four enforced changes from the side which beat Chorley convincingly last Wednesday. Lee Milner replaced Richard Acton in goal, Colin McAllister came in for George Melling at centre-back and John Maloney started in place of Nehru McKenzie. Acton, Melling and McKenzie were all required as named substitutes for the first team at Aldershot today. The fourth change saw Kwame Barnett replace the injured Kieran Lugsden up front.

Alty went behind after six minutes following a Bamber Bridge corner. McFadden scuffed his attempted clearance and the ball ran to the back post where it struck an incoming Brig player, despite the presence of four defenders, and went into the net for a somewhat fortunate goal. For the next 25 minutes Alty created more chances than their opponents but went two-down after 32 minutes. The goal came after a foiul by McAllister for which the linesman flagged. Alty stopped playing but the referee waved play on and Milner was left facing a one on one from which the striker scored.

After 36 minutes it became 3-0 when Alty tried unsuccessfully to play the offside trap leaving Milner again exposed in a one on one situation. After 42 minutes, Bamber Bridge made it 4-0 when a mis-header by Mike Brown fell to the Brig left-back. Monaghan got in a block tackle but the ball rebounded behind him. A Brig player then got past Marsden to score.


Half-Time: BAMBER BRIDGE RESERVES 4
ALTRINCHAM RESERVES 0

Manager Neil Brown delivered a "brisk" half-time talk and opted to adapt his game-plan to counter Brig's 4-3-3 formation. This change, to a 3-5-2 formation, with McAllister, Marsden and Monaghan at the back, was implemented after 53 minutes by means of a double substitution as Sutton replaced Mike Brown and Heffernan came on for Stewart. Then on the hour mark Jones was replaced by Bingham. Alty were the better side in the second half and got a goal back after 70 minutes. As a Brig defender hesitated, Bingham gained possession from the defender's weak pass and knocked the ball round the keeper and into the net to make it 4-1.

An unawarded penalty, after Barnett had been brought down, did not help Alty's cause. Despite the outcome, manager Neil Brown was not downhearted as the team had played some good football, especially in the second half, and gained good experience of countering a 4-3-3 formation but had let themselves down with suicidal defending in the first half.


Full-Time: BAMBER BRIDGE RESERVES 4
ALTRINCHAM RESERVES 1
